              Well, I tried, and I mean really tried to like this game. Multiple plays. Learnt the controls. Etc etc.

              But it is terrible. I am sorry, but there's no better adjective to describe the game than terrible. The score here of 3/10 is about right.

              There's absolutely NO NBA pace to this game. It's just half court set after half court set. If I take a bad shot from the wing, the cpu never punishes me by fast breaking. They walk it up and enter a half court set. There's absolutely ZERO dynamic AI / reactive AI in this game. I manually took my defender away, I manually didn't bother to get back after misses and never did the CPU punish me in any way. You can leave JR Smith wide open and if the CPU has decided they are posting up Tyson Chandler for a 10 foot fade away (side note, there are NO tendencies in this game) then that's what they do. This is a really, really generic game of half court basketball.

                            So I put some time in with the demo today since I'm hearing a lot of positive things in here about the game. I hadn't played it since it came out.

                            I think it plays a solid game of basketball. I like the weighted feeling of the players. I like the pace of the game and the less complicated controls. Although I wish there was a tutorial.

                            I also really don't think the graphics are all that bad. Yes, they aren't what next-gen should be. But I'll give them a pass this year because I know this game has been in development for last gen systems for years.

                            As far as gameplay, I just really like the simplicty of the controls. I like the quick plays mapped to the d pad. The pick and roll is very well done. The game really does feel like a slightly upgraded version of Live 10. And I loved Live 10.

                            I've always liked Live. 05 was one of my favorite sports games ever. I just get more of a fun factor from Live than I do from other basketball games.

                            I want to get my hands on a retail copy to see what improvements have been made from the demo. I know there is supposed to be a lot, so that's really encouraging. I will consider buying it if that's the case.

                            I honestly appreciate what EA is doing with this game. They got a playable game out the door. That's huge. I think some people just don't get how big of a deal that is. They also seem to be serious about post-release support. This shows a commitment to take back significant market share from the other game. I don't care that it's taken them this long to put a game out. That's water under the bridge. People need to let that go. Its not letting them off the hook.

                            So yeah, now I really wanna play the retail version. I almost bought it on Amazon today since its $45. But I just don't know if its worth it until I play it.

                            I'll be sure to comment more when I finally do get to play it.
